Since we were missing fireworks this year, I started thinking about the best fireworks show I've experienced (and I'm sure my boy would agree...) We were in Sorrento, Italy on our honeymoon, and one night we heard a great big BOOM -- so loud and close that the room shook. We were mildly freaked! Turns out, they were shooting fireworks off the dock below our hotel... no apparent reason, other than the fact that the town across the bay had done it the night before and it was decided that Sorrento could do better. We had a great view, being right above the water, and we were as close as I'd ever been. On top of that, it was a pretty impressive display -- would have put any 4th of July celebration I'd seen to shame. So I sorted through some pictures and thought I'd share a few:
